Cheesy Bechamel-Covered Meatballs
Ingredients
  • We’ve said it before and we’ll say it again, meatballs are just as good as a stand-alone dish as they are when paired with spaghetti and red sauce, and these ones are covered in a creamy, cheesy bechamel sauce that’s impossible to resist. We serve this dish with a crusty loaf of garlic bread and it gets completely demolished when we set it down on the table. Get yourself a side of greens and call it a day…these meatballs steal the show every time!
  • subheading: Meatballs:
  • ¾ pound ground beef
  • ¾ pound ground pork
  • 1 ½ cups mozzarella cheese, grated
  • ⅓ cup parmesan cheese, grated
  • ⅓ cup seasoned breadcrumbs
  • 2 cloves garlic, minced
  • 1 large egg
  • 1 tablespoon milk
  • ½ teaspoon dried basil
  • ½ teaspoon dried oregano
  • ¼ teaspoon red pepper flakes
  • kosher salt and freshly ground pepper, to taste
  • subheading: Sauce:
  • 2 cups whole milk
  • 3 tablespoons unsalted butter
  • 2 tablespoons all-purpose flour
  • ⅛ teaspoon ground nutmeg
  • kosher salt, to taste
